Jennifer Ertman and Elizabeth Peña were two best friends from Houston, Texas who were brutally raped and murdered by a gang as an initiation ritual on a summer night in 1993. The suspects involved were all charged with the girls’s murders and faced death penalties.
Jennifer Louise Ertman was born on August 15, 1978 and Elizabeth Christine Peña was born on June 21, 1977. The girls became close friends as they grew up and attended Waltrip High School in Houston, Texas. The parents of the girls admired their friendship. Elizabeth’s father even stated that Jennifer was a such great influence on Elizabeth.


On June 24, 1993, Jennifer’s father Randy dropped her off at Elizabeth’s home at around 4:15 P.M. Then at about 8 P.M. Elizabeth’s mother Melissa dropped both Elizabeth and Jennifer at their friend Gina’s house, whom was having a pool party. The girls agreed to come back by their 11:30 P.M. curfew.
After having fun and partying with friends, the girls realized that they would be late for their curfew, so they hurriedly left to make it on time. The girls chose to take a 10 minute shortcut to get back to Elizabeth’s home faster. This is when they encountered danger.


As they were following along the shortcut, Elizabeth and Jennifer encountered a group of 6 men, Peter Cantu, José Medellin, Sean Derrick O’Brien, Efrain Pérez, Raul Villarreal, and Venancio Medellin, with Venancio being the youngest at 14 years old at the time. It was about 10:30 P.M. when the gang had finished initiating Raul Villarreal Into their gang by fighting the other members. About 40 minutes after this, the girls encountered the men all drinking beers and talking. As the girls passed, José Medellin attempted to grope one of Elizabeth’s breasts, to which she brushed it off. José then exclaimed, “No baby! Where [are] you going?!” , grabbing Elizabeth by her neck and dragging her down a gravel incline going towards the other members. Instead of running away, Jennifer bravely went to go help her best friend. She was then thrown to the ground by other gang members.

After raping the girls, the leader of the gang Peter Cantu didn’t want to risk the girls identifying them, so he ordered the other members to kill the girls. As the gang left the scene, Peter handed Venacio Medellin a Goofy wristwatch that was taken from Jennifer’s body, saying, “Take this, I don’t want it.”

All of the members except for Sean O’Brien then met up at Peter Cantu’s home, where he lived with his brother Joe Cantu and his sister in law Christina. Christina noticed that Raul was bleeding and Efrain had blood on his shirt and questioned the men on what happened. José Medellin responded that they “had fun” and more details would be on the news later. He then went on to talk about the rapes. Peter Cantu later divided valuables that they stole from the girls among the members. This included a ring with an “E” on it that José Medellin later gave to his girlfriend Esther. José and the other men continued to talk about the murders, stating that it would’ve been easier with a gun. Once the gang left the home, Christina convinced her husband Joe that he needed to report his brother and the gang to the police.
On June 28, 1993, the girls remains were discovered in the park. Due to the hot weather conditions, the bodies were badly decomposed and they had to be identified through dental records. Their cause of deaths were determined to be strangulation. At the crime scene, Jennifer’s father Randy had to be held back by multiple people as he was hysterical and trying to see if it was really his daughter they found. Unbeknownst to others, one of the killers, Sean O’Brien, was at the crime scene with his younger brother and watched with a smile as the girls’ bodies were being removed. After being reported to the police, the men involved in the murders were arrested.

During the trial, Peter Cantu, José Medellin, Sean O’Brien, Efrain Pérez, and Raul Villarreal were all given death sentences. However, Efrain Pérez and Raul Villarreal’s sentences were later reduced to life in prison after the Supreme Court ruled that executions were banned for people who committed the crime when they were under the age of 18. Because Venancio Medellin was only 14 at the time of the murders, he was given a 40 year sentence. Sean O’Brien was the first to be executed via lethal injection on July 11, 2006. After appealing his execution several times, José Medellin was finally executed via lethal injection on August 5, 2008. Finally, the leader Peter Cantu was executed via lethal injection on August 17, 2010. After requesting parole, Venancio Medellin was denied in 2020.
